You’ll delve into the medieval classroom, where you’ll discover the methods and materials used to teach students the basics of reading and writing. You’ll also investigate the medieval curriculum, which was based on the seven liberal arts and emphasized the study of classical texts.
You’ll discover the importance of manuscripts in the Middle Ages, and the painstaking process by which they were created. You’ll also explore the role of libraries, which were essential centers of learning and scholarship. And you’ll meet the medieval reader, a diverse group of people who included monks, scholars, merchants, and even peasants.
Through this exploration of medieval literacy, you’ll gain a deeper understanding of this transformative period in history. You’ll see how the rise of literacy helped to fuel the Renaissance and the Reformation, and how it laid the foundation for the modern world. And you’ll come to appreciate the enduring legacy of medieval literacy, which continues to shape our lives today.
